Program: SM3, SM5, SM7.
Production volume in 2003 - 117,630 vehicles. Samsung
Heavy Industries Co., a producer of trucks from 1994-2001, launched the
production division for passenger vehicles Samsung Motors Inc in 1995. From 1996-97 a series of 40 electric SEV IV
hatchbacks were built, followed in 1997 by the debute of the SSC-1 concept car. In the
same year trial production was initiated on the SM5 sedan, whose series
production began in January 1998. In 2000 Renault acquired 70.1% of Samsung Motors shares (19.9% remained in Samsung
hands and 10% were bank-owned). Latest premieres: September 2002 - a new SM3; at the 2002 Seoul Motor Show - a prototype of
the
SM3 Sport; 2003 Busan Motor Show - SM5 restyling, November 2004 - SM7, January 2005 - second generation
SM5. Plans for the future: 2006 - SM4 (SUV). Annual production for 2006 is planned at 500,000 vehicles.
